Texas Capital Bank (TCB), a Texas‑based commercial bank, needed to launch an in‑house commercial card quickly while avoiding the time, cost, and liability of handling sensitive card data and PCI compliance. To meet that challenge, TCB partnered with Very Good Security and used Very Good Security’s Zero Data platform to implement a PCI‑avoidant architecture.

By building the card infrastructure on Very Good Security’s Zero Data approach, TCB never touched sensitive data, stayed out of PCI scope, and avoided vendor lock‑in while retaining 100% data ownership. The solution let TCB launch months ahead of alternative builds—saving an estimated 6–9 months in time, money, and resources that were redirected to product development and growth.
